加载随机VAST的VPAID javascript媒体文件

时间:2016-11-09 16:31:38

标签: javascript advertising vast

我想要一个VPAID javascript从我拥有的XML文件列表中选择一个随机VAST,并通过广告容器加载它。

我知道如何更改广告位的DOM以及更改<video>的{​​{1}}属性,以便它可以播放不同的视频,但我不知道&#39 ;了解如何将新VAST加载到广告容器中。 我想我可以在媒体文件脚本中动态加载ima3.js库,并将VAST应用到广告容器,但我认为这是一种更简单的方法。我对吗?有没有更好的做法来实现这一目标?

提前致谢。

1 个答案:

答案 0 :(得分:0)

您可以创建一个服务器,从列表中选择XML并返回正确的XML。我相信这是行业标准。

e.g。

  1. 创建名为ads.com的服务
  2. ads.com运行一个随机选择XML并将其返回的函数
  3. 当SSP调用ads.com时,它会获得随机XML
  4. 使用此方法,您可以根据用户cookie或设备等设置提供不同的XML。